Comprehending the German Drogerie
To really appreciate the German pharmacy, one must initially comprehend the difference in between a Drogerie and an Apotheke (pharmacy).
- The Apotheke (Pharmacy): This is where prescription medications, strong over-the-counter drugs, and specialized medical advice are dispensed. They are strictly controlled and generally staffed by pharmacists in white coats.
- The Drogerie (Drugstore): This is where one opts for health, Arzneimittelshop Deutschland beauty, personal care, child items, cleaning up products, and healthy foods. Prescription drugs are not offered here.

Founded in 1973, dm is a cultural example in Germany. Germans regularly vote dm as their favorite retailer. The stores are carefully arranged, wheelchair- and stroller-friendly, and lit with warm, welcoming lighting. dm is particularly well-known for pioneering the "private label" revolution in Germany, offering premium-quality cosmetics and skin care at a portion of the expense of name brand names.
2. Dirk Rossmann GmbH (Rossmann)
As the second-largest chain, Rossmann is ubiquitous throughout German towns and cities. Rossmann is known for aggressive discounting, weekly voucher books, and a great digital app. While its store design can sometimes feel slightly more utilitarian than dm, its item variety is equally excellent.
3. Müller
Müller stands apart since it functions practically like a mini-department store. While it has the exact same substantial drugstore and natural food sections as dm and Rossmann, a typical Müller will also include an enormous toy department, a stationery and book area, and a high-end luxury perfume counter.

The Magic of German Drugstore House Brands (Eigenmarken)
Among the best tricks of the German drugstore is the quality of its private-label brand names. In lots of countries, store-brand products are seen as inexpensive, inferior alternatives to call brand names. In Germany, the reverse is typically real.
German customer publications (like Stiftung Warentest) frequently test drugstore home brands against high-end brand names, and Eigenmarken regularly win leading honors for quality, component security, and worth.
Popular House Brands to Look For:
- Balea (dm): The undisputed king of spending plan body care. From shower gels that alter scents seasonally to abundant body milks and facial serums, Balea is a cult favorite.
- Alverde (dm): A qualified natural cosmetics (Naturkosmetik) brand that is exceptionally budget friendly.
- Isana (Rossmann): Similar to Balea, providing a huge selection of hair, skin, and bath items with piece de resistance evaluations.
- Babylove (dm) & & Babydream (Rossmann): Lifesavers for moms and dads, using high-performing diapers and child care products without the premium cost.
Tips for Shopping Like a Local
If you wish to mix in seamlessly during your next journey down the pharmacy aisles in Germany, keep these useful ideas in mind:
- Bring Your Own Bags: Like most German retailers, drugstores do not give out complimentary plastic bags. Constantly bring a recyclable tote bag (Jutebeutel).
- Download the Apps: If you live in Germany or go to regularly, download the dm or Rossmann apps. They offer digital coupons, commitment points, and scratch-and-win discount rates that can save you a substantial quantity of money.
- Store the Sale Bins: Near the front or center of the shops, you will typically discover clearance bins featuring seasonal items, discontinued scents, or Nahrungsergänzungsmittel online kaufen Deutschland overstocked products heavily discounted.
- Examine the Certifications: German customers care deeply about sustainability. Look for trusted German seals on products, such as:
- Natrue: Certified natural cosmetics.
- Vegan Flower: Certified 100% vegan items.
- Blauer Engel: Germany's main eco-label for eco-friendly products.
- Coin for the Shopping Cart: If you need a shopping cart, you will need a 1-euro or 50-cent coin to open it (which you get back when you return it).
